H3NRY THR!LL returns with a stunning statement of intent in new single ‘EMOTIONLESS’

After a brilliant breakout year, LA-based producer H3NRY THR!LL kicks off 2022 with a groovy bass house banger which adamantly asserts him as one of most versatile and talented artists in the scene. Both psychedelic and anthemic, ‘Emotionless’ equips the listener with a track that could be blasted out at a club or calmly consumed in the comfort of their own company.

 

H3NRY begins the captivating cut with an interstellar sounding synth alongside a daunting, grumbling bass, creating a spacey environment that is reinforced with reverberating percussion throughout. Sharp snares steadily build up to the climax of ‘Emotionless’, a hypnotic house groove with a silky-smooth kick, a variety of soothing synths and an underlying distorted bass. A feature from Mo Bentley takes the sensational song to the next level, her raspy vocals add enticing emotion and consistent catchiness while concisely written lyrics meticulously match the gloomy tone, providing a cutting illustration of an emotionless relationship, a comment on modern love.

 

Speaking about the latest addition to his already impressive discography H3NRY explained, “This release is a big new step for the new year and the new sound. Working with Mo Bentley on this track was awesome and her voice fits this track perfectly. Coming into 2022 with a strong string of releases and having this one lead the pack. Combining catchy melodic elements with the deep bass sound, I am certain you are going to love Emotionless.”
